The meaning and "use of": uphill

adjective
  • sloping upward; ascending. - the journey is slightly uphill
adverb
  • in an ascending direction up a hill or slope. - follow the track uphill
noun
  • an upward slope. - Incredibly strong winds, and countless steep grades, and uphills , and the strain of a heavy trailer, and a worn differential made for low traveling speed.
